Zverev beats Tien in straight sets to reach French Open second round

Overcoming pre-tournament illness coupled with a lightning-triggered flight diversion, the third seed now eyes his first Grand Slam title.

Overview

  • Alexander Zverev dispatched American teenager Learner Tien 6-3, 6-3, 6-4 on Court Suzanne Lenglen in his opening match.
  • He adopted an aggressive approach to overturn a prior Acapulco defeat and seize control of the contest.
  • The world number three managed health setbacks that impacted his Hamburg performance and endured a lightning-struck flight delay en route to Paris.
  • Zverev has advanced to at least the semifinals in each of the past four French Opens but remains in pursuit of a maiden major championship.
  • Next up is a second-round clash with Dutch qualifier Jesper de Jong, who prevailed over Francesco Passaro in five sets.
